Qt и QScintilla2 фатальная ошибка LNK1120 при установке
Я буду настолько ясен, насколько могу, о том, что я сделал до сих пор, у меня проблемы с этой установкой, потому что я не до конца знаю, что происходит с компиляторами и т. Д., И здесь мне нужна помощь. Так я и сделал:
- установлена Visual Studio 2010
- используя msvc2010 на Qt
- установил переменные окружения, чтобы иметь каталог, где у меня есть nmake.exe*
каталог: C:\Program Files (x86)\Microsoft Visual Studio 10.0\VC\bin, и здесь у меня есть nmake.exe, link.exe... но у меня также есть папка amd64 и папка x86_amd64 с другим nmake.exe и link.exe
Я использую командную строку Visual Studio 2010 и Windows 7 (64bit)
Теперь я создаю make-файлы с помощью qmake, и после этого я сделал nmake, и вот ошибка:
некоторые из них:
LeXAPDL.obj : error LNK2001: unresolver external symbol ___report_rangecheckfailure
и это:
release\qscintilla2.dll : fatal error LNK1120: 4 unresolved externals
NMAKE : fatal error U1077: '"c:\Program Files (x86)\Microsoft Visual Studio 10.0\VC\BIN\link.exe"' : return code '0x460'
Stop.
NMAKE : fatal error U1077: '"c:\Program Files (x86)\Microsoft Visual Studio 10.0\VC\BIN\nmake.exe"' : return code '0x2'
Stop.
Теперь, так как я не разбираюсь в консоли, у меня есть некоторые проблемы, делающие то, что я хочу, я думаю, что-то не так с компиляторами / компоновщиками, и я не знаю точно, что делать, чтобы это исправить